Product Description:
The HCS01.1E-W0009-A-02-A-CC-EC-PB-L3-NN-FW belongs to the HCS IndraDrive Controllers series and functions as a single-axis drive controller. Within line code HCS01 and design version 1, it supplies regulated power to servo and induction motors while linking the axis to higher-level PLCs. In industrial automation, it modulates torque, speed, and braking energy so machine tools, packaging stations, and material-handling axes can follow commanded motion profiles with repeatable accuracy. This arrangement allows one controlled axis to respond quickly to motion commands while remaining integrated with the rest of the machine control system.
The controller accepts a three-phase supply of 3 × AC 110…230 V ±10% and can deliver up to 9 A of peak output current to the connected motor. Heat is removed by internal air cooling through an integrated blower, so no external ducting is required. An enclosure rating of IP20 allows installation inside protected cabinets. The power section is paired with an ADVANCED control section, which enables extended motion functions. Its infeeding and supply concept supports regenerative energy flow on the shared DC bus, allowing braking energy from the axis to be fed back into the system during deceleration.
System communication is handled through a SERCOS III master (cross communication) channel for deterministic real-time data exchange between the controller and adjacent drive components. Motor feedback is processed through the Encoder IndraDyn Hiperface/EnDat 2.1/2.2 interface, while higher-level controller integration is provided by PROFIBUS. This combination supports coordinated motion control, status exchange, and closed-loop feedback in one drive platform. Motion disable is available through the embedded STO (Safe Torque Off) interface, which allows safety-related torque shutdown without external contactors. The device also communicates its infeeding status so supplied power can be coordinated with adjacent axes on a shared DC bus.
